Toronto Blue Jays hitter Vladimir Guerrero Jr. has seen a significant decline in his offensive performance throughout the 2026 season. Through 126 games and 533 plate appearances, he has recorded only eight home runs, all of which occurred during road games. Analysis indicates his home run rate has dropped to 1.5% compared to his 4.3% career average entering this year. In addition to a decrease in home run power, data shows a decline in his barrel rate and a worsening chase rate. These offensive struggles have contributed to a slugging percentage of.357, marking a career low for the player. The Blue Jays continue their schedule through September as the team evaluates his role.
